**Q: How long are tax rates cached in Quillrate?**

The lookup cache holds jurisdiction rates for 24 hours, keyed by region code. Entries are invalidated early when the Ledgewick feed pushes a correction. Cache contents are read-only to application code and never include taxpayer data. The full invalidation design is documented on our internal wiki page.

runbook for hawif-tajeg: https://grafana.plorvasoft.example/dash

### Action item: slim the Bramblecast plugin base image

Root cause: bloated base image pushed cold-start past the gateway timeout. Fix: multi-stage build, stripped toolchains, pinned runtime layer. Plugin authors: rebuild against the slim base by next release; oversized images will be rejected at publish. Size and timeout thresholds now enforced are as follows.

tuning table, yajog-yahof:
BUDGETS = {
    "lamvan": 303,
    "wenox": 460,
    "fenvan": 525,
}

# NOTE FOR MAINTAINERS: This module is the first slice carved out of the
# old Hartlem monolith's user subsystem. Account lookup and session refresh
# now live here; profile editing still lives upstream until the Quillbrook
# migration finishes. Keep these constants in sync with the legacy defaults
# until then, or login latency spikes on the Vexport cluster. The current
# tuning values are listed below.

limits module of tawep-hawif:
WEIGHTS = {
    "sordor": 228,
    "kasax": 458,
    "ulaox": 8,
    "casix": 495,
    "briix": 335,
}

// PARTNER_SFTP_DROP_PATH
//
// Destination for the nightly Corvane settlement files pushed to the
// Ostwild partner drop. The uploader retries three times with backoff;
// after that it pages on-call. Do NOT rename files in the drop — the
// partner's poller matches exact prefixes and silently skips anything
// else. If uploads stall, check the firewall allowlist first, then the
// key rotation job. The uploader build currently deployed is noted below.

build token for kagaf-hahof: htk14_9d3d4d26d7d8de